# %WIKITOOLNAME% Site-Level Preferences The following are **_site-level_** settings that affect all users in all webs on this [[TWikiSite]]. They can be selectively overwritten on the **_individual web level_** (see [[WebPreferences]] in each web), and on the **_user level_** (create preferences in your user account topic in the Main web, ex: Main.admin). - %X% **NOTE:** You can lock individual settings at the site or web levels using User & Group Access Control - see section below.

- Skin overriding the default TWiki templates: (can be overwritten by [[WebPreferences]] and user preferences) - Set SKIN = ## Email and Proxy Server Settings - TWiki webmaster email address: - Set WIKIWEBMASTER = - Mail host for outgoing mail. This is used for [[WebChangesAlert]] if Perl module **Net::SMTP** is installed. If not, or if `SMTPMAILHOST` is empty, the external sendmail program is used instead (defined by **$mailProgram** in **TWiki.cfg**). Examples: **mail.your.company** or **localhost** - Set SMTPMAILHOST = mail - Mail domain sending mail. SMTP requires that you identify the TWiki server sending mail. If not set, **Net::SMTP** will guess it for you. Ex: **twiki.your.company** - Set SMTPSENDERHOST = - Proxy Server. Some environments require outbound HTTP traffic to go through a proxy server. Set the host in PROXYHOST (example: **proxy.your.company**), and the port number in PROXYPORT (example: **8080**). No proxy is used if PROXYHOST or PROXYPORT is empty. - Set PROXYHOST = - Set PROXYPORT = ### Email Link Settings - 'Mail this topic' mailto: link - can be included in topics, templates or skins - Set MAILTHISTOPIC = [%MAILTHISTOPICTEXT%](mailto:?subject=WebHome&body=%TOPICURL%) - 'Mail this topic' link text - Set MAILTHISTOPICTEXT = Send a link to this page - URL for current topic - Set TOPICURL = ## Plugins Settings - [[TWikiPlugins]] configuration: All plugin modules that exist in the `lib/TWiki/Plugins` directory are activated automatically unless disabled by DISABLEDPLUGINS. This is simply one quick approach.)_: - Set H = HELP - Set I = IDEA! - Set M = MOVED TO... - Set N = NEW - Set P = REFACTOR - Set Q = QUESTION? - Set S = PICK - Set T = TIP - Set U = UPDATED - Set X = ALERT! - Set Y = DONE - Background color of non existing topic: ( default `cornsilk` or `#FFFFCE` ) - Set NEWTOPICBGCOLOR = #FFFFCE - Font color of non existing topic: ( default `#0000FF` ) - Set NEWTOPICFONTCOLOR = #0000FF - [[PreviewBackground]] image: - Set PREVIEWBGIMAGE = ![preview2bg.gif](http://www.dementia.org/twiki//view/TWiki/PreviewBackground/preview2bg.gif) ## Access Control Settings - Users or groups allowed to change or rename this %TOPIC% topic: (ex: [[TWikiAdminGroup]]) - Set ALLOWTOPICCHANGE = - Set ALLOWTOPICRENAME = - Users or groups allowed to [[create new webs|TWiki/ManagingWebs]]: (ex: [[TWikiAdminGroup]]) - Set ALLOWWEBMANAGE = [[TWikiAdminGroup]] - Site-level preferences that are **not** allowed to be overridden by [[WebPreferences]] and user preferences: - Set FINALPREFERENCES = PREVIEWBGIMAGE, WIKITOOLNAME, WIKIWEBMASTER, SMTPMAILHOST , SMTPSENDERHOST, ALLOWWEBMANAGE ## Creating New Preference Variables You can introduce new VARIABLES and use them in your topics and templates. There is no need to change the TWiki engine (Perl scripts). - A preference is defined in a [[TWikiShorthand]] bullet item: **[3 spaces] \* [space] Set NAME = value**
Example (as a nested bullet item, indented 6 spaces): - Set WEBBGCOLOR = #FFFFC0 - Preferences are used as [[TWikiVariables]] by enclosing the name in percent signs: **%**. Example: - When you write variable **%WEBBGCOLOR%**, it gets expanded to `%WEBBGCOLOR%` . - %X% The sequential order of the preference settings is significant. Define preferences that use other preferences FIRST. For example, set **WEBCOPYRIGHT** before **WIKIWEBMASTER** since the copyright notice uses the webmaster email address. ## Related Topics - [[WebPreferences]] has preferences of the %WIKITOOLNAME%.%WEB% web. - [[TWikiUsers]] has a list of user topics.
